Scholarships Available for Indonesian Students
1. Chevening Scholarships
Overview: The Chevening Scholarships are offered by the UK government to exceptional emerging leaders from around the world. Indonesian students can apply for fully funded scholarships to pursue master's degrees in the UK.
Application Timeline: Applications will open in early April 2026 and will close in July 2026.
Eligibility Criteria:
- Must hold Indonesian nationality.
- At least two years of work experience.
- Meet the English language requirement, usually via IELTS or other accepted tests.
2. Erasmus Mundus Scholarships
Overview: Funded by the European Union, Erasmus Mundus scholarships support students from outside Europe. Indonesian students can apply for joint master’s programs across participating European universities.
Application Timeline: The application opens in mid-May 2026, with specific deadlines that vary by program.
Eligibility Criteria:
- Bachelor’s degree or equivalent.
- Fulfill specific requirements of the chosen program.
3. Fulbright Scholarship Program
Overview: The Fulbright Program offers scholarships for Indonesian graduate students aiming to study in the United States, funded by the U.S. government.
Application Timeline: Applications will be accepted from April to mid-June 2026.
Eligibility Criteria:
- Must be an Indonesian citizen.
- Hold a bachelor’s degree or equivalent.
- Proficiency in English, typically demonstrated by TOEFL or IELTS scores.
4. DAAD Scholarships for Development-Related Postgraduate Courses
Overview: These scholarships promote international students, including Indonesians, pursuing master’s programs in development-related fields at German universities, funded by the German government.
Application Timeline: Generally open for applications until the end of May 2026.
Eligibility Criteria:
- Relevant academic background in development.
- At least two years of professional experience in a related field.
How to Prepare Your Scholarship Application
Research the Scholarships Thoroughly
It's important to understand the specific requirements for each scholarship. Students should dedicate time to review the eligibility criteria, application processes, and deadlines carefully.
Gather Necessary Documents
Commonly required documents include:
- Academic transcripts.
- Letters of recommendation.
- A personal statement or essay outlining your goals and motivations.
- Proof of language proficiency.
Plan Ahead for Language Tests
Many scholarships require proof of English proficiency through tests such as IELTS or TOEFL. Preparing for these tests can be time-consuming, so students should plan to take the test well in advance to allow for retesting if needed.
Tailor Your Application
Different scholarships may have unique requirements regarding personal statements. Customizing your application to express your motivation and qualifications for each scholarship can significantly enhance your chances.
Network and Seek Guidance
Connecting with past scholarship recipients or academic advisors can provide valuable insights and tips for crafting a successful application. Also, attending workshops on the application processes can deepen your understanding.
